Institutional Integration: The Embedded Banking Model
One of the most significant features of the current P2P landscape is the embedded banking model, exemplified by services like Zelle. Unlike standalone applications, this technology is integrated directly into existing banking infrastructure, utilizing the bank’s own security layers and user interface. This integration matters because it utilizes the ISO 20022 standard, a global messaging protocol that allows for more detailed data to travel with every payment. This technical foundation ensures that transactions are not just fast but also highly interoperable with traditional accounting systems used by major corporations.
The performance of these bank-centric models is characterized by massive scale, processing billions of transactions annually with near-zero latency. By bypassing the traditional Automated Clearing House (ACH) delays, which can take days to settle, these embedded systems offer real-time settlement rails that provide immediate liquidity to the recipient. This implementation is unique because it maintains the regulatory oversight of the banking sector while delivering the speed of a modern mobile app.
Social-First Financial Interfaces: Beyond the Transaction
In contrast to the institutional model, social-centric interfaces like Venmo and Cash App focus on the psychological and community-driven aspects of money movement. These platforms combine financial ledger technology with social media features, such as transaction feeds and emoji-based descriptions. This social layer is not merely decorative; it serves as a powerful retention tool that turns a mundane financial task into a form of social engagement. By creating a public or semi-public record of exchange, these apps have cultivated a unique culture where “Venmoing” someone has become a verb, synonymous with the act of settling a shared debt.
Beyond the novelty of social engagement, these platforms offer high performance in user retention and brand loyalty. They serve as lifestyle tools that incorporate secondary features like stock trading, cryptocurrency exchange, and group bill-splitting algorithms. This diversification allows the apps to capture a larger share of the user’s daily routine, moving toward a “super-app” status where financial management, investing, and social networking coexist. This model is particularly effective for demographics that may feel alienated by traditional banking, as it offers a more approachable and interactive interface for complex financial operations.

Real-World Applications and Sector Deployment
P2P technology has moved beyond simple person-to-person transfers into diverse commercial sectors. In the small business arena, independent contractors and market vendors use these systems for instant liquidity, avoiding the delays and high processing fees associated with traditional credit card merchants. This shift allows micro-businesses to manage cash flow more effectively, as funds are available for use seconds after a sale is completed. The gig economy has also been a primary beneficiary, with platforms offering instant payouts for freelancers and service providers, which provides a significant advantage over bi-weekly payroll cycles.
Other notable implementations include the real estate sector and government aid distribution. Landlords are increasingly adopting P2P systems for the digital collection of rent and security deposits, which simplifies record-keeping and eliminates the risk of bounced checks. Furthermore, non-profits and government agencies are utilizing these rapid-settlement rails for the distribution of emergency aid or the collection of charitable donations during crises. This ability to move funds quickly and accurately to specific individuals has proven invaluable in disaster relief scenarios, where traditional banking infrastructure may be compromised or too slow to meet urgent needs.
Critical Challenges: Addressing the Fraud Epidemic
Despite its rapid adoption, the technology faces a significant fraud epidemic that threatens to undermine consumer confidence. Because P2P transfers are often instantaneous and irrevocable, they have become a primary target for social engineering scams, including “authorized push payment” (APP) fraud. In these scenarios, bad actors manipulate users into voluntarily sending money under false pretenses, leaving the victim with little recourse since the transaction was technically authorized. This vulnerability highlights a critical trade-off: the very speed that makes P2P attractive also makes it a dangerous tool in the hands of sophisticated criminals.
Regulatory hurdles also remain a significant concern as many platforms operate in a shadow banking capacity where user balances may lack traditional FDIC insurance. Furthermore, the lack of interoperability—the “walled garden” effect where different apps cannot communicate with one another—remains a technical hurdle that creates payment friction. If a user on one platform cannot send money to a friend on another, the efficiency of the entire ecosystem is diminished. Bridging these gaps will require industry-wide standards and potentially government intervention to ensure that the P2P market does not remain a fragmented landscape of isolated networks.
The Future Trajectory: The Path toward Total Digitalization
The outlook for P2P technology involves the total digitalization of Business-to-Consumer (B2C) and Business-to-Business (B2B) payments. Future developments will likely center on Request for Pay (RfP) systems, where digital invoices are sent directly to a user’s payment app for one-tap approval. This would revolutionize bill payment by providing consumers with more control over the timing of their outflows while giving companies immediate confirmation of payment. As these systems mature, the distinction between a “payment app” and a “bank account” will likely disappear entirely, leading to a unified digital financial identity for every user.
